Your day begins with a comfortable hotel pick-up by our professional guide, ready to introduce you to Antalya’s cultural and natural treasures. The first stop is the Upper Düden Waterfall, a peaceful spot surrounded by lush greenery where you can walk along the pathways and take memorable photos.
Next, you will continue to the Lower Düden Waterfall, where the water dramatically cascades 40 meters directly into the Mediterranean Sea – one of Antalya’s most iconic natural sights.
Depending on the timing of the tour, the Talya Stone Factory will be visited.
The tour then continues with a guided walking tour of Kaleiçi, Antalya’s charming Old Town. Here, you will step back in time as you explore landmarks such as Hadrian’s Gate, the Clock Tower, the Broken Minaret, and Hıdırlık Tower, while strolling through narrow cobbled streets filled with history and character.
To complete your day, you will join a one-hour boat trip from the historic marina, offering stunning views of the city’s coastline and cliffs from the sea. After this refreshing cruise, you will be comfortably transferred back to your hotel.
Antalya is a stunning coastal city in Turkey, known for its beautiful beaches, rich history, and vibrant culture. It's a perfect blend of ancient ruins, modern amenities, and natural beauty, making it a top destination on the Turkish Riviera.
Kaleiçi is the old town of Antalya, known for its Ottoman-era architecture, narrow streets, and charming atmosphere. It's a great place to explore the city's history and enjoy local cuisine.
Düden Waterfalls is a stunning natural attraction where the Düdendere River cascades down cliffs into the Mediterranean Sea. It's a popular spot for picnics and photography.
Aspendos Ancient Theatre is one of the best-preserved Roman theaters in the world. It's still used for performances and concerts, offering a unique blend of history and modern entertainment.
